  • One of the most notable features of automatic computerized sewing machines is their ability to store and recall stitch patterns. Users can select from a vast library of predefined stitches, ranging from simple straight stitches to complex decorative designs. With just the press of a button, users can switch between patterns, making it possible to create detailed projects without the need for manual adjustments. This versatility not only saves time but also encourages creativity by allowing users to experiment with different designs effortlessly.

  • 3. Versatility Modern industrial overlockers can handle various types of fabrics, including knits, wovens, and stretch materials. This versatility makes them ideal for a range of applications, from simple hems to more complex garment constructions.

  • As you sew, be mindful of the thickness of the leather and adjust the pressure foot tension as needed. You may also need to hand-turn the wheel on your machine when sewing through particularly thick areas, like at the seams.
